Timo P. Pitkänen is a scholar working on Environmental Engineering, Ecology and Global and Planetary Change. According to data from OpenAlex, Timo P. Pitkänen has authored 26 papers receiving a total of 368 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 15 papers in Environmental Engineering, 11 papers in Ecology and 11 papers in Global and Planetary Change. Recurrent topics in Timo P. Pitkänen's work include Remote Sensing and LiDAR Applications (15 papers), Forest ecology and management (7 papers) and Forest Ecology and Biodiversity Studies (7 papers). Timo P. Pitkänen is often cited by papers focused on Remote Sensing and LiDAR Applications (15 papers), Forest ecology and management (7 papers) and Forest Ecology and Biodiversity Studies (7 papers). Timo P. Pitkänen collaborates with scholars based in Finland and Sweden. Timo P. Pitkänen's co-authors include Pasi Raumonen, Laura Alakukku, Hannu Känkänen, Yrjö Salo, Sakari Tuominen, Niina Käyhkö, Annika Kangas, Elise Ketoja, Jaana Peippo and Mauritz Vestberg and has published in prestigious journals such as The Science of The Total Environment, Geoderma and Forest Ecology and Management.
